Insulet Corporation Shareholders: Legal Action Opportunity Post Losses

In a significant development for investors, Insulet Corporation (PODD) is under scrutiny due to allegations of securities fraud. Glancy Prongay Wolke & Rotter LLP has announced that shareholders who have incurred financial losses are now afforded the chance to take the lead in a class action lawsuit against the company.

Background


The allegations center on claims that between February 21, 2025, and May 26, 2026, Insulet Corporation's leadership made materially false and misleading statements. They reportedly failed to disclose crucial adverse facts that could have significantly affected the company's operations and prospects, specifically concerning the safety of its products. The firm asserted that issues concerning the manufacturing controls introduced a risk, indicating that some products might not meet safety regulations and could pose serious health risks to users.

Lawsuit Details


The class action complaint asserts that investors were misled by the company’s prior optimistic claims about its operations, which were contradicted by the reality of their defective practices. As a result of these discrepancies, investors who bought securities during the specified period could be entitled to recover their losses through the lawsuit.
